This project investigates factors influencing the immune response to viral infections, particularly the type I interferon system. Using a diverse cohort, it aims to identify demographic and biological variables that affect antiviral immunity, with potential implications for improving infection resistance.
Both antiviral immunity and susceptibility to viral infections are remarkably variable.
Factors such as older age, increased body mass index, and male sex can increase the risk of developing severe viral disease, yet the impact of these features on antiviral immunity, particularly the type I interferon system (IFN-I), is not understood.
Here we propose to use a systems immunology approach to identify features that influence IFN-I responses and understand their impact on infection susceptibility.…
